Clinical outcomes stratified per group, based on COVID-19 postoperative diagnosis
| Variable | Results for postoperative COVID-19 |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Negative | Positive | |||
| Hospital stay (days) | Mean (SD) | 1.5 (4.2) | 9.5 (17.8) | <0.001a |
| Median (min–max) | 1 (0–63) | 2 (0–58) | ||
| Clavien-Dindo classification | 0 | 917 (99.6) | 5 (0.4) | 0.026b |
| I | 229 (97.9) | 5 (2.1) | ||
| II | 74 (100) | 0 | ||
| III–V | 66 (97.0) | 2 (3.0) | ||
| Operative time (min) | Mean (SD) | 109.0 (96.5) | 175.0 (199.0) | 0.016a |
| Median (min–max) | 84 (5–825) | 162.5 (45–451) | ||
| Blood transfusion | No | 1265 (99.1) | 11 (0.9) | 0.187b |
| Yes | 21 (95.5) | 1 (4.5) | ||
| Type of anesthesia | General with or without regional | 922 (99.1) | 10 (0.9) | 0.632b |
| Regional with or without sedation | 165 (100) | 0 | ||
| Local with or without sedation | 199 (99) | 2 (1) | ||
| Intensive care unit stay | No | 1232 (99.3) | 9 (0.7) | 0.013b |
| Yes | 54 (94.6) | 3 (5.4) | ||
| Readmission | No | 1240 (99.3) | 9 (0.7) | 0.007b |
| Yes | 44 (93.5) | 3 (6.5) | ||
| Month of surgery (2020) | May | 88 (96.7) | 3 (3.3) | 0.010b |
| June | 205 (97.6) | 5 (2.4) | ||
| July | 254 (100) | 0 | ||
| August | 261 (99.2) | 2 (0.8) | ||
| September | 313 (99,7) | 1 (0.3) | ||
| October | 165 (99.4) | 1 (0.6) | ||
SD standard deviation; min–max minimum–maximum
aMann-Whitney test
bFisher exact test
